Topics not normally included in a physical chemistry text include extensive discussions of active transport chapter 5, the physical basis for the energy released during the hydrolysis of atp, the unequivocal statement that a cell at equilibrium is a dead cell chapter 6, and in chapter 7 on electrochemistry there is an extended discussion of.
